When selecting a PE tarp roll, focus on durability and materials. High-density polyethylene (HDPE) is recommended for its tear resistance. According to a recent market study, HDPE tarps can endure harsh weather conditions better than standard options. This offers significant value for outdoor projects or protective coverings.
Consider the thickness of the tarp roll. Thickness often correlates with strength and longevity. For instance, a 6 mil tarp delivers adequate protection for most outdoor applications. However, if you're working in a more demanding environment, a 10 mil version might be necessary. Notably, 70% of users report needing thicker tarps after initial purchases. This signals a need for careful consideration.
Weight is another critical feature to assess. A heavier tarp may provide better longevity but can be unwieldy to handle. Ensure that the weight matches your intended use. Moreover, check for UV resistance if long-term exposure is expected. Users often overlook this, leading to premature wear. PE tarps are versatile, yet misjudging features can lead to dissatisfaction. When selecting a PE tarp roll, assessing the quality and durability of materials is crucial. PE tarps are popular due to their water resistance and UV protection. The thickness of the tarp can indicate its durability. Thicker tarps, usually 10 mils or more, tend to last longer. Look for reinforced edges; these prevent tearing and extend the tarp's lifespan.
Tips: Check for UV treatment to ensure longevity in sunlight.
Color can also play a role. Darker colors typically offer more UV protection, but lighter colors reflect heat. Consider the environment where you plan to use the tarp. Choosing the right PE tarp roll involves understanding your budget and the factors that influence costs. Prices can vary widely based on size, thickness, and durability. For instance, thicker tarps tend to be more expensive but offer better protection against the elements. Knowing how often you will use the tarp can help you decide how much to spend.
When budgeting for a PE tarp, consider the additional costs. Shipping fees and taxes can add to your total expense. Look for sellers that provide detailed information on their products. Transparency in pricing helps build trust. A breakdown of costs can clarify what you’re paying for.
